\nThe Role:
\nYou will work as part of the specialist CDM and Building Safety team, supporting clients and internal design teams with the delivery of Principal Designer, Principal Designer Advisor and CDM Client Advisor services.
\nThe wider team provides a comprehensive range of building safety services, health and safety consultancy, fire safety advice, safety cases, training, site audits and quality inspections.
\nThis is an excellent opportunity for an experienced CDM professional who enjoys working closely with designers and clients on technically interesting projects. You will be involved throughout the project lifecycle, helping teams identify, manage and communicate health and safety risks from the earliest design stages through to practical completion.
\nThe position would suit someone who is confident advising clients and design teams, understands how buildings are designed and constructed, and can provide practical rather than overly procedural CDM advice.
\nDuties and Responsibilities:
\nUndertake and lead Principal Designer and Principal Designer Advisor duties under the Construction (Design and Management) Regulations 2015.
\nAdvise clients, architects, consultants and wider project teams on their responsibilities under CDM 2015.
\nSupport internal design teams in applying CDM requirements and industry best practice.
\nReview designs and help project teams identify, eliminate or control foreseeable health and safety risks.
\nAssist designers with the preparation and maintenance of design risk registers.
\nAttend design team meetings, progress meetings, client meetings and project workshops.
\nPrepare clear CDM reports, advice notes and project correspondence.
\nCoordinate, review and manage pre-construction information.
\nEnsure Health and Safety Files are properly compiled, completed and handed over to the client by practical completion.
\nDeliver CDM and health and safety workshops to internal teams, clients and project stakeholders.
\nUndertake construction site inspections and health and safety audits where appropriate.
\nProvide CDM Client Advisor services, helping clients understand and discharge their statutory duties.
\nMaintain accurate project records using the consultancys project management and document control systems.
\nDevelop relationships with existing clients and identify opportunities for additional CDM and building safety services.
\nSupport the Associate Director in mentoring and guiding less experienced members of the CDM team.
\nMaintain an up-to-date understanding of CDM legislation, construction health and safety requirements and relevant industry guidance.
